编程之家(jb51.cc)编程百科栏目主要推荐程序员常用编程技术介绍,以下是Web应用开发相关编程语言,主要信息提供给程序员快速了解所需要学习的编程技术语言。
Ajax技术相关: 在你使用Ajax开发应用程序的过程中需要用到很多相关的技术,XMLHttpRequest,Javascript,DOM,XML等.当然你觉得要写很多javascript代码会很烦,你可以使用Ajax框架也可以.只是用不同的方式达到相同的效果而已.最终目的都是为了满足你的欲望.比如:Atlas.虽然这些东西不一定全部用到,但是XMLHttpRequest对象却是实现Ajax应用必
在项目开发中,我们会经常用到一种数据结构—树。”树”这种数据结构名称的灵感完全来自自然界的树,在计算机中,树是倒着长的,根在上,叶子在下。 下面来介绍下,在使用ExtJs进行实际项目开发过程中,怎样才能构建一颗树,其中分为静态树和动态异步树两种类型。如图所示   一、静态树   以上TreePanel提供了树形结构数据的树形UI展示。添加到TreePanel中的每个TreeNode都可以包含你的程
<!DOCTYPE html> <html> <head>     <title>ajax框架</title>     <meta charset="utf-8">     <script type="text/javascript">         function ajax(url,success,error){             if(window.XMLHttpRequest){
1.Purejavascript: Application Frameworks 1.1Bindows (成立于2003年) Backbase是一个通过DHTML、JavaScript、CSS和HTML等技术强劲联合起来的一套完整的Windows桌面式的WEB应用程序解决方案。Bindows无需下载安装客户端支撑组件(如Java、ActiveX或Flash),仅需一个浏览器。纯OO的理念体现在Bi
最近由于项目需要,专心研究了一下Ajax的相关程序设计,本来一开始想用Prototype或者jQuery等框架,后来发现其实用不到这些框架里面的那么多内容,强行使用的话只能拖累我网站的访问者,降低用户体验,因此决定自己写一套适合自己需求的Ajax代码库。   在这套Ajax代码库中,实现了如下的功能: 1、Ajax远程调用数据 2、通过Ajax异步提交Form表单 3、返回数据后,能够将数据绑定到
很多网页设计师在工作中经常会用到Ajax交互式技术。Ajax可实现很多种交互方式,最常用的有lightboxes、表单验证、导航、搜索、tool-tips和表格等等。不过令人惊奇的是,大多数网页设计师并没有发挥Ajax技术的最大潜力,大多数时候重复使用着相同的脚本,更别说和JavaScript结合。下面跟大家分享10个顶级的免费Ajax和JavaScript框架,相信能让设计师们的网页应用开发更上
用AJAX来控制书签和回退按钮 作者:Brad Neuberg 译者:boool 版权声明:任何获得Matrix授权的网站,转载时请务必以超链接形式标明文章原始出处和作者信息及本声明 作者:Brad Neuberg;boool 原文地址:http://www.onjava.com/pub/a/onjava/2005/10/26/ajax-handling-bookmarks-and-back-bu
         前边我们针对以XMLHttpRequest为核心学习了AJAX的相关知识,接下来,重点学习一下微软在ASP.NET中的AJAX的框架的基础学习,主要是AJAX Extension中的几个控件,如下图:     而,这篇博客,我们来重点看一下ScriptManager的学习。而我主要是通过他的属性来进行学习的。            一,概述:ScriptManager控件包括在A
          上一篇博客学习了ScriptManager这个异步刷新必备的控件,这篇博客再来学习UpdatePanel这个非常重要的控件。             先来看一个概念:UpdatePanel控件是用来局部更新网页上的内容,网页上要局部更新的内容必须放在UpdatePanel里边。主要用于定义页面更新区域和更新方式。             然后来学习一下UpdatePanel的属
         上两篇博客简单学习了ScriptManager和UpdatePanel两个异步刷新的核心控件,这篇博客继续学习ASP.NET AJAX框架中的其它三个控件。           一,首先看ScriptManagerProxy控件,它和ScriptManager非常相似,那为什么它出现呢?在ASP.NETAJAX中,由于一个ASPX页面上只能有一个ScriptManager控件,所
转载之:http://blog.csdn.net/weihj1999/article/details/1370794 一、AJAX由来   Ajax这个概念的最早提出者Jesse James Garrett认为:   Ajax是Asynchronous JavaScript and XML的缩写。   Ajax并不是一门新的语言或技术,它实际上是几项技术按一定的方式组合在一在同共的协作中发挥各自的
昨天接到组长的任务,要我增加页面实现对系统的日志表的增删查改,一开始想,这不是之前经常做的吗,很简单,组长说周五之前完成,我说行。结果说完这句话半小时之后我就有点担心了,因为这个程序的编写方法跟之前接触的编程方法差别很大,在学校学习的小程序在这里感觉连塞牙缝的的资格都没有,程序里面都是在用JS脚本操作。而且用的是Buffalo,这就是我跟这个国产的Ajax框架的第一面,而这的一面确实吓了我一大跳。
    之前学习aps.net的时候学习过使用服务器端去访问webservice的方法,当时实现了一个例子:web server模拟网上购物,今天学习asp.net ajax的时候学习到了客户端直接访问webserivice的方式。这种客户端直接访问webserver的方式体现了ajax的异步刷新数据的思想。 客户端访问webservice基础 webservice端的创建步骤: 1.创建一个ap
更多信息请移步:http://xiebaochun.github.io/ 一、ExtJS简介          Ext是一个Ajax框架,用于在客户端创建丰富多彩的web应用程序界面,是在Yahoo!UI的基础上发展而来的。官方网址:www.sencha.com          ExtJS是一个用来开发前端应用程序界面的JS框架,借鉴Swing等思想,提供了一套完整的组件库及强大的ajax支持功
Border布局: Ext.onReady(function(){     Ext.QuickTips.init();     Ext.create('Ext.container.Viewport', {   //一般是渲染到viewport中         title: "table布局的面板",         layout:'border',         defaults: {   
       关于Ajax的概念不再做解释了,我想通过三个小例子来让大家对Ajax有个清晰的认识。要学习它,必须从最基础最原始的方式开始认识,然后通过使用框架来提升效率,逐步认识它。 一.原生js版(注册的用户名是否重复的校验) 前端js代码: <script type="text/javascript"> var xmlHttpRequest; function createXmlHttpR
      在平时网页中看电影的时候经常能够注意到就是在看电影的时候,底部有对电影的评论,点击评论分页的下一页没有重新刷新页面,这时候用到的则是Ajax异步刷新。这对于用户体验有所提高,因为要是电影看到一半点击评论的下一页,整个页面立马生效,这时候电影又重新加载,且不就打击用户么。下面用Ajax实现无刷新数据分页功能。此时借用的是Smarty+MySQL+Ajax实现   首先设计数据库中表的字段
     用Ajax实现分级联动的例子是比较常用的,此案例用PHP+MySQL+Ajax来实现。首先要导入自己封装好的js文件。然后新建一个html显示的文件       <!DOCTYPE html PUBLIC "-//W3C//DTD HTML 4.01 Transitional//EN" "http://www.w3.org/TR/html4/loose.dtd"> <html> <hea
      Ajax在搜索功能应用还是比较广泛的,例如百度搜索输入框,输入一个字会跟着显示很多相似的文字。      接下来是用PHP+MySQL+Ajax实现功能     <!DOCTYPE html PUBLIC "-//W3C//DTD HTML 4.01 Transitional//EN" "http://www.w3.org/TR/html4/loose.dtd"> <html> <he
关于命名 j dist s 就是 js 里插入了一个 dist (分发),避免和其他组件命名冲突,同时特殊好记。 本工具专注于前端代码块(js、css、html)预处理。 起因 一个页面从开发到上线基本会经历三个阶段: 本机开发调试 打印一些变量和执行状态、模拟数据接口 内网测试 跳过某些步骤、使用内网环境 公网上线 移除调试代码、使用线上环境。 其实前端代码和其他语言代码都需要编译,目前已经有很